Blast resistance of polyurea based layered composite materials

TL;DR: In this paper, layered and sandwich composite materials, comprising of polyurea (PU) and E-glass vinyl ester (EVE) composite are experimentally evaluated for effective blast resistance using a shock tube.

Pullout behavior of polypropylene fibers from cementitious matrix

TL;DR: In this paper, a comprehensive experimental investigation was performed to understand the pullout behavior of polypropylene fibers from a cementitious matrix and the effect of exposure to degrading environments, like seawater and salt water, on the interfacial bond between the fibers and cementitious matrices were studied.

The blast resistance of sandwich composites with stepwise graded cores

TL;DR: In this paper, two types of core configurations, with identical areal density, were subjected to the shock wave loading, and the results showed that configuration 1 outperformed configuration 2 in regards to their blast resistance.

Fabrication, characterization, and dynamic behavior of polyester/TiO2 nanocomposites

TL;DR: In this paper, the effects of nanosized particles on nanocomposite bulk mechanical properties were investigated using a direct ultrasonification method, and the presence of the particles had the greatest effect on fracture toughness; negligible influence was observed in the remaining quasi-static properties.

Blast Mitigation in a Sandwich Composite Using Graded Core and Polyurea Interlayer

TL;DR: In this article, the dynamic behavior of two types of sandwich composites made of E-Glass Vinyl-Ester (EVE) facesheets and Corecell™ A-series foam with a polyurea interlayer was studied using a shock tube apparatus.
